body.overlay-contain {
	position: relative;
}
.overlay::after {
		content: none;
		width: 100%;
		height: 100%;
		position: absolute;
		left: 0;
		top: 0;
		opacity: 0.4;
		z-index: 80;
	}
.overlay.home-overlay::after {
			background-image: url(/overlays/home-320.jpg);
		}
@media (min-width: 768px) {
.overlay.home-overlay::after {
				background-image: url(/overlays/home-768.jpg)
		}
			}
@media (min-width: 1024px) {
.overlay.home-overlay::after {
				background-image: url(/overlays/home-1024.jpg)
		}
			}
@media (min-width: 1280px) {
.overlay.home-overlay::after {
				background-image: url(/overlays/home-1280.jpg)
		}
			}
.overlay.projects-overlay::after {
			background-image: url(/overlays/projects-320.jpg);
		}
@media (min-width: 768px) {
.overlay.projects-overlay::after {
				background-image: url(/overlays/projects-768.jpg)
		}
			}
@media (min-width: 1024px) {
.overlay.projects-overlay::after {
				background-image: url(/overlays/projects-1024.jpg)
		}
			}
@media (min-width: 1280px) {
.overlay.projects-overlay::after {
				background-image: url(/overlays/projects-1280.jpg)
		}
			}
.overlay.project-overlay::after {
			background-image: url(/overlays/project-320.jpg);
		}
@media (min-width: 768px) {
.overlay.project-overlay::after {
				background-image: url(/overlays/project-768.jpg)
		}
			}
@media (min-width: 1024px) {
.overlay.project-overlay::after {
				background-image: url(/overlays/project-1024.jpg)
		}
			}
@media (min-width: 1280px) {
.overlay.project-overlay::after {
				background-image: url(/overlays/project-1280.jpg)
		}
			}
.overlay.inspiration-overlay::after {
			background-image: url(/overlays/inspiration-320.jpg);
		}
@media (min-width: 768px) {
.overlay.inspiration-overlay::after {
				background-image: url(/overlays/inspiration-768.jpg)
		}
			}
@media (min-width: 1024px) {
.overlay.inspiration-overlay::after {
				background-image: url(/overlays/inspiration-1024.jpg)
		}
			}
@media (min-width: 1280px) {
.overlay.inspiration-overlay::after {
				background-image: url(/overlays/inspiration-1280.jpg)
		}
			}
.overlay.media-overlay::after {
			background-image: url(/overlays/media-320.jpg);
		}
@media (min-width: 768px) {
.overlay.media-overlay::after {
				background-image: url(/overlays/media-768.jpg)
		}
			}
@media (min-width: 1024px) {
.overlay.media-overlay::after {
				background-image: url(/overlays/media-1024.jpg)
		}
			}
@media (min-width: 1280px) {
.overlay.media-overlay::after {
				background-image: url(/overlays/media-1280.jpg)
		}
			}
.overlay.biography-overlay::after {
			background-image: url(/overlays/biography-320.jpg);
		}
@media (min-width: 768px) {
.overlay.biography-overlay::after {
				background-image: url(/overlays/biography-768.jpg)
		}
			}
@media (min-width: 1024px) {
.overlay.biography-overlay::after {
				background-image: url(/overlays/biography-1024.jpg)
		}
			}
@media (min-width: 1280px) {
.overlay.biography-overlay::after {
				background-image: url(/overlays/biography-1280.jpg)
		}
			}
.overlay.contact-overlay::after {
			background-image: url(/overlays/contact-320.jpg);
		}
@media (min-width: 768px) {
.overlay.contact-overlay::after {
				background-image: url(/overlays/contact-768.jpg)
		}
			}
@media (min-width: 1024px) {
.overlay.contact-overlay::after {
				background-image: url(/overlays/contact-1024.jpg)
		}
			}
@media (min-width: 1280px) {
.overlay.contact-overlay::after {
				background-image: url(/overlays/contact-1280.jpg)
		}
			}
.overlay.overlay-on::after {
			content: "";
		}


/*# sourceMappingURL=overlay.css.map*/